Weber-Stephen

Weber-Stephen is one of the oldest and most respected manufacturers of BBQ equipment and related accessories in the world. Weber grills and smokers cook beautifully and have great features that are clever, effective and easy to use. As popularity and demand for BBQ gear grows worldwide, Weber continues to earn their long standing reputation for quality, durability and outstanding customer service and support, (7 days a week from 7am to 9pm CST), in an increasingly competitive environment. Even in this crowded marketplace, many consumers are still willing to pay more for the Weber name and they are rarely disappointed. They make a variety of cookers and smokers. Their iconic black charcoal kettles are known throughout the world. Indeed Weber is expanding globally.

Weber-Stephen was family owned since it was founded in 1952 by George Stephen. At the end of 2010 the Stephen family sold a majority stake to Chicago investment group BDT Capital Partners. In 2012, Weber settled a class action suit out of court regarding their use of the phrase, "Made in USA". Weber previously qualified the "Made in USA" statement by specifying their products are assembled in the USA with some components that are sourced globally. Here is an excerpt from Weber's statement "Weber believes that because all Weber grills and the disputed accessories are designed and engineered in the USA, and all grills save for one line [Spirit]* are manufactured and assembled in the USA using component parts primarily made in the USA, it did nothing wrong and therefore has valid defenses to plaintiff's claims. The court has not held a trial or ruled in favor of either party on any disputed issues. Weber and the plaintiff have agreed to settle the matter to avoid the costs of continued litigation." As a result of this suit, Weber can no longer claim to be made in America.

Things change, but we believe Weber's commitment to quality and innovation has not.

The biggest barrier for many folks is price. Webers are not cheap, but when you consider that they last decades, the price is easy to justify. In fact, when you consider the fact that some cheap grills fall apart after three years or so, Webers might be considered a bargain.

Our main complaint: All Webers have the obligatory bi-metal dial thermometer in the hood that gives you a ballpark reading of what the temperature is high above the meat. Since we cook on the grates, though, it's always better to bring your own digital thermometer and place a probe there. It would be nice if they would go digital in the digital age and it appears with their acquisition of iGrill digital thermometers, this is begining to change.

*At the very end of 2016 Weber introduced their new line of Genesis II gas grills to replace the popular Genesis series. Genesis II is made in China. Genesis II LX is still made in Palatine, IL.

Weber Gas Grills

Weber gas grills are simply the gold standard. Designed intelligently with attention to details and built to last, they look good, work beautifully, and almost never break down. If they do, Weber is known for great customer service and for carrying an inventory of parts on models from years gone by. Meathead owned a Genesis for 15-years and can testify from experience.

All their burners are quality stainless steel, have a long life expectancy, and they come with electronic ignitions. The body is heavy. The casters are sturdy and lock solid. Nothing wobbles on Webers. The grease drip pans are easy to access from the front, not the back as with many other grills. Except for the portable/compact Q line, all models hold the propane tank inside the enclosed cart, and can be adapted for natural gas. They have smaller vents in the hood than most gassers which means they retain more heat than grills with more BTUs.

All have inverted V shaped "flavorizer" bars that cover and protect the burners while vaporizing drips and turning them into flavor that gets back up onto the meat. Except for the Q line, all either come with a rotisserie or you can order one as a factory accessory.

Weber gas grills come in four basic flavors, Q, Spirit, Genesis II, and Summit, each with several configurations. Models starting with an "E" are built with Weber's sturdy porcelainized enamel coated steel, and those starting with an "S" are mostly stainless steel.

Addressing an increased interest in outdoor kitchens, in 2011 Weber introduced add on "Island Cabinetry" and "Social Centers", pictured above, to integrate with the Summit lines. These range from matching side tables with enclosed storage to cart mounted side burners, enclosed trash cans and large "Social Areas" that serve as a bar with double door storage underneath. There is also a faux stone island with matching countertops.

Much has been made of 430 and 304 stainless steel: the two most popular grades used by grill manufacturers. Many other inexpensive brands use very thin, low cost 430 stainless to get that shiny showroom floor look. Premium grill makers tout their use of higher quality, higher priced 304 stainless. At some point, Weber decided to switch from 304 to 430. Although 304 is superior, 430 can work just fine if it is a thick gauge like Weber uses, but it is not as durable and one has to expect the life of the grill will be shortened. Will this decision could come back to haunt the castle in Palatine? Only time will tell. Alas, it does not appear Weber's prices were reduced to reflect the cost savings realized with this change.

Weber's Q series started out as small, portable gas and electric grills. Many owners found they liked their little Qs both on the go or at home. So Weber added a few larger models and put some of them on small carts. Although Weber's quality and service usually justify their higher prices, there are a lot of mid and large size economy grills in the Q price range. That said if these small to compact cookers fit your size requirements, they are fun and functional with an appealing, modern look.

Q grills have coated, cast aluminum housings, porcelain enameled cast iron grates, stainless steel burners on gas models, electric ignition, removable grease pans and most come with the obligatory heat indicator in the lid. The cast iron grates are split so one side may be removed and replaced with an optional cast iron griddle.

Silver Medal

This compact grill grew from the popularity of Weber's small portable Q 100/120 and 200/220 models. Many owners found they liked these little grills both on the go or at home. So Weber made them bigger with hose and regulator for a 20lb. LP tank standard and put them on a small cart. In 2014 Weber began offering natural gas models as well. They have some nice features for an apartment/patio style grill for small spaces. The 393 square inch primary cooking surface is big for a space saver. Although Weber's quality and service usually justify their higher prices, once you get into this price range there are an awful lot of choices that provide more for the money. That said if the Q 3200 fits your size requirements, it's fun and functional with an appealing, modern look.

3200 has a coated, cast aluminum housing with the obligatory heat indicator in the lid. Like the large cooking area, the lid has a bit more height than many compacts, enabling owners to cook roasts and chickens. There are 2 stainless steel burners. One burner wraps around the perimeter of the firebox and a second burner runs through the middle from side to side. Set both burners on high for direct heat cooking and shut off the middle burner to create a small indirect section. Grates are porcelain-enameled cast iron. The cart is nylon and has two removable, fold-down side shelves with tool hooks. Two large wheels on the right side with a bottom shelf for the LP tank which is concealed by a thin nylon sheet. A slide out catch pan at the bottom of the firebox holds a disposable grease pan and may be accessed from under the left side shelf.

It includes battery powered ignition, a 69 square inch warming rack and a Weber Grill Out LED light on the handle that illuminate the grill surface.

Weber Q 3200

Got Limited Space?

The Bottom Line

The Q 3200 gas grill grew out of the popularity of the original Q. This super-sized model is designed more for the person who has limited space than the person who needs to transport their grill. At 83 pounds all together, this isn't a grill to take on a picnic. This grill does, however, provide you with indirect cooking abilities and as much space as a small, traditional gas grill.

This grill will give you authentic grilling right down to the warming rack in a unit that is easily stored and doesn't take up a lot of space.

  • A portable grill that is large enough to do most anything
  • Solid construction for good heat retention and grilling characteristics
  • A good grill for apartment dwellers
  • A big and heavy portable grill
  • At full price, this is comparable to full sized grills with more features

Description

  • 21,700 BTUs from two tubular stainless steel burners
  • 393 square inches of primary grilling space for a total cooking area of 468 square inches
  • 2 porcelain coated cast iron cooking grates
  • Electric (AA-battery) ignition
  • Large hood promises to make room for a whole chicken or large roasts
  • Hood-mounted temperature gauge
  • Two foldout side tables
  • Weighs in at 83 pounds. This includes the grill, stand, hose, and regulator
  • Operates on a standard 20-pound propane tank
  • Available in propane or natural gas - not convertible
  • Made in the USA

Guide Review - Weber Q 3200

When Weber introduced the Q portable gas grill they found a lot of people not taking it to the beach but keeping it on their patio. It was a perfect grill for urban dwellers that didn't have a backyard but still wanted to grill. In 2006, Weber introduced the Q 3200, a larger, two-burner gas grill that comes standard with the previously optional stand.

This unit also comes standard with the hose and regulator to hook it to a 20-pound propane tank. After all, at 21,700 BTUs, it would go through disposable, 1-pound bottles very fast.

While not strictly a portable, this grill is a great compromise between a large full feature grill and a traditional portable, making it perfect for apartment dwellers or tailgaters. The two-burner design gives you indirect cooking abilities. One burner runs around the edges of the grilling area while the other cuts through the middle. This gives the grill the power it needs to heat 393 square inches of cooking area hot enough to grill steaks while giving you a lot more versatility in your grilling.

For the price, the construction of this Weber is a good grill. The straightforward design is a model of simplicity and the grill doesn't rely on lots of extras. This is a basic unit grill, perfect for someone who wants to grill small meals in a small place.

Weber Q 3200 Portable Grill Reviews and Ratings

Weber Q 3200 Portable Grill Reviews and Ratings

The Weber Q 3200 portable grill is one of Weber’s best sellers. It is the updated version of their Q320, a very popular model. The Weber Q 3200 is available in both a liquid propane and a natural gas version. Because the Weber Q 3200 is billed as a portable unit, we find that the liquid propane version is a more popular seller. As a result, that’s the version we focus on in our ratings. Weber has been making grills for five decades, the granddaddy of barbecues. And they’re still cooking, still innovating and coming up with advanced models and accessories. Their motto is “By grillers, for grillers.”

Here is a look at the Weber Q 3200 from a user’s point of view to help you decide if this is the right model for you. There is an overall summary of its features, then a look at what people like about it and what they don’t.

Number of Reviews: 212 (as of February 18, 2017)

Number of Reviews: 66 (as of February 18, 2017)

95% of customers recommend this grill.

Read the reviews

Weber Q 3200 in a Nutshell

The Q 3200 Liquid Propane Grill has two burners made of stainless steel that produce 21,700 BTU an hour. This is enough to heat 393 square inches of cooking space. It operates off a 20-pound propane tank, which is not included. The Q3200 also comes in a natural gas version. In addition:

  • The grates are cast iron with porcelain-enamel coating. The body and lid are made of cast aluminum. It is mounted on a wheeled cart for ease of movement.
  • The split grates make it easy to use it for a combination of foods, both grate and griddle, at the same time. The griddle is sold separately.
  • The burner valve uses infinite control and will lock in at the temperature you specify. Starting is easy, just push a button with the electronic ignition.
  • It has a warming rack, built in thermometer and a grill handle light. To organize tools, there are three hooks and a place to stow the warming rack. The propane tank is secured on a bracket in back.

This is the new redesign of the Q320, which has been discontinued. Here’s how the Weber Q 3200 is different than the Q 320:

  • More ergonomic side handles
  • New front and rear cradles
  • New larger fold-down side tables with better rigidity

Q 3200 Open with Dinner

Convenient Grease Tray

Best Features of the Weber Q 3200

Six features stand out on the Weber Q 3200:

  • The push button ignition means turning it on is a snap.
  • Porcelain enameled iron cooking grates heat evenly and are easy to clean.
  • The aluminum hood is lightweight.
  • The side tables provide extra room while cooking and can be dropped down to take up less room when you are finished.
  • The large cooking surface means you can cook a lot of food at once.
  • The optional griddle is handy makes it versatile; for example, if you want to cook bacon for breakfast.

Watch the Weber Q3200 Video

What Users Like and Dislike About the Weber Q 3200 – The Reviews

Number of Reviews: 212 (as of February 18, 2017)

Number of Reviews: 66 (as of February 18, 2017)

95% of customers recommend this grill.

Read the reviews

  • The Q3200 gets high marks, especially when it comes to cleanup, temperature control and size.
  • Cooks love the porcelain cooking grids because they are easy to clean. The entire unit is made for quick cleanup.
  • Users also like the fact that the grates heat quickly and uniformly and the grill has few flare ups. Once you set the temperature, it heats up rapidly.
  • It works well for all types of meat and vegetables.
  • The cooking surface is large relative to the size of the unit. It can cook meat and vegetables for six quickly and conveniently.
  • It can be used for breakfast, lunch and dinner. The optional griddle gets rave reviews. One advantage is that if you bacon and eggs outside, you don’t have to worry about bacon grease in the house.
  • It can easily handle a large mound of home fries. Burgers, hot dogs and steaks cook quickly and are juicy. The unit sears food evenly and speedily.
  • It can be used to slow-cook ribs, briskets and whole chickens. It is perfect for roasting, even a 20-lb. turkey comes out cooked to perfection. If you like to smoke food, it has a handy smoke tube.

  • One major drawback is the fact that it has no flavor bar like the larger Weber grills, and offers no option for using lava rock or briquettes. This is a problem for those who like using them.
  • Though it comes on a sturdy cart with wheels, it is heavy and fairly large, making it what one user called “semi-portable.” The warming rack is handy but it would be nice if it were larger.
  • It’s a bit of a challenge to assemble. Some people find the instructions less than crystal clear. It takes about 1.5 hours to assemble.

Is the Weber Q 3200 Right For You?

  • If you live in an apartment, it is an excellent size. If you don’t like a lot of cleanup, this is a good model for you.
  • If you use your grill often, this is a good choice because it is easy to turn on, easy to clean. This also makes it convenient if you are grilling for just one or two people.
  • If you routinely grill for six or more, the big cooking surface makes this a handy model to get.
  • If aesthetics are important to you, this is a good choice. The overall design is sleek. And the food comes out looking attractive.

  • If you don’t have the space, patience or ability to assemble it, you might have problems when it arrives. One way around this is to pay Amazon to put it together for you and ship it complete, for an additional fee.
  • If flavor bars, briquettes and lava rock are important parts of your grilling routine, this is not the right model for you.
  • If you need to move the grill around a lot and you don’t have much room, this may not be the best choice. It is considered semi-portable and is heavy, though it does have wheels on its cart.

Overall the Weber Q3200 Liquid Propane Grill gets high marks from users. It looks sleek and is easy to start and to clean. It cooks a wide range of food quickly and evenly.
